I know what you mean about the game seeming short. My first play through was extreamly quick I'd finished the compainions guild, war quest the main quest and thieves guild all in a few days on a friends PC.

When I got my copy I also picked up the game guide. What I found out is I'd missed most of the radient quests that lead onto more of the guild plot. Like the Thieves guild I'd missed the quests that built the guild back up to it's former glory. So I'd not got every fence in the game with 4k cash or had the shops in the sewers. I'd also missed the totem quests for the compainions and the dragon maske collection.

Some of the guild quests are really hard to find, if it hadn't been for the game guild I'd have never found out how to finish the thieves guild stuff or found out about the shrines of the nine....

If your not finding enough to do I'd very much recomend the game guide, it points you to lots of awesomeness. Even if you've done the things I missed the first time through it has much much more than that in it.

I'm 123ish hours in with my second character. I've done all but the compainions and I'm still find hours of stuff to do thanks to the guide.
